Output 87b5d52a183eddd76d29e085d989e4ff6b0010ae001cc80ae123898dd5d5ae65:3

value
18218200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f259545e92f4ce767b87360af56a71200aaeb7 OP_EQUAL
address
3BAdr15HuFR6yHQrAeTiuAKz7ob4sPe68r
transaction
87b5d52a183eddd76d29e085d989e4ff6b0010ae001cc80ae123898dd5d5ae65
confirmations
337382
spent
true